Looking for high quality 1/4" and 1/8" connectors. Calrad was recommended in another thread but the user also stated they were hard to come by.

Any advice appreciated.

You mean 1/4" to RCA adapters? Calrad is the only known one who makes good ones (teflon insulated). Neutrik makes good 1/4" and 1/8" plugs along with canare.

Sorry for the confusion--I'm looking for connectors (to solder on the end of cables), not adapters. I'm trying to eliminate adapters.

The Neutriks are very good. I just made up some cables using the Neutrik NP2C-BAG, which is a good 1/4 inch mno phone plug, available at most parts stores (I got mine from fullcompass.com). There is a gold-plated version, but I didn't bother with it as the jacks in the DI/O aren't gold either.
